Thomas Alexander

January 13, 1933 — September 28, 2020

Van Wert, Ohio

Thomas Bryan Alexander, age 87, passed away peacefully September 28th, 2020 surrounded by his loving family. He was born to Fern (Conley) Adams and Mike Alexander. 67 years ago he married the love of his life Sylvia Ann (Thomas), who survives.

He was a 1951 graduate of Union Township School. Tom then served in the Army, 13th Infantry Regiment, at Camp Atterbury then Fort Carson. When he returned home he farmed, until someone gave him the opportunity to build. It started with a grain bin and then a building. He started Alexander & Bebout, Inc. in 1965 with his business partner, Gene Bebout. He loved being a contractor and the buildings he built, but especially the A&B team and all of the clients and relationships he made over the years. Tom was an upstanding member of the community and served on many boards and organizations throughout his life, including the BDC( Business Development Corporation), CIC (Community Improvement Corporation), Downtown Review Board, Elks, American Legion, Moose, and a lifetime member of North Union United Methodist Church, which A&B built. He was the 2005 recipient of the Ray Miller Outstanding Community Service Award from the Van Wert Chamber of Commerce.

Building a close-knit family was important to Tom. He enjoyed spending time with them at Hamilton Lake, beating them at playing cards, and telling everyone "The thing to do.....".
